Mumbai-based Clirnet Services, a digital healthcare firm, has appointed Krishna Kumar Banka as its new Chief Technology Officer (CTO).
Banka will lead Clirnet’s AI-driven technology initiatives across its key platforms, including the doctor-focused Doctube.com.
With over 27 years of experience in software development, AI, and technology leadership, Banka has previously worked with Synopsys, Cadence, Keysight Technologies, and Capgemini Engineering. His background includes building scalable systems through agile software practices, managing global engineering teams, and driving cross-functional tech projects. He holds two U.S. patents and a registered trade secret.
Banka’s role as CTO will involve leading Clirnet’s end-to-end technology strategy as it expands its offerings for doctors, patients, and the healthcare industry.
Confirming the appointment, Clirnet's co-founder, Saurav Kasera, said, “His experience building scalable AI systems and leading agile teams will be crucial as we expand our offerings.”
Banka will work closely with Clirnet's co-founder, Ashu Kasera, who will now focus on product innovation and building globally scalable healthcare platforms from India.
“I am excited to join Clirnet,” said Banka. “The opportunity to leverage AI and digital innovation to empower healthcare professionals and improve outcomes is compelling. I look forward to scaling operations and transforming user experiences.”
Clirnet operates a digital platform that serves nearly 4 lakh doctors in India. It offers tools and services designed to support last-mile delivery of affordable patient care. The firm has partnered with medical institutions, associations, and healthcare stakeholders.
